The American romance is a kind of literary mutation in the history of 19th century Western novel. Since the mid 1940s, critics have appropriated it in one way or another for the construction of American canons dominated by Anglo-Saxon white male writers. The romance has been wily exploited as a central medium in the ideological manipulation of the canonicity of American novel. Hawthorne’s theory of romance, scattered mostly in his prefaces, among which “The Custom-House” is commonly referred to as the crucial manifestation of his theory of romance, famously known as “a neutral territory”, is indispensable in critical thinking of the ideology of romance discourse. In this paper, the various historical implications of Hawthorne’s idea of romance are analyzed in comparison with those of other self-styled romance writers in and out of the American republic of letters such as William Gilmore Simms, Poe, Henry James, E.T.A Hoffmann and Mikhail Bulgakov. Through this comparative study, a creative (dis)continuation of Hawthorne’s Romance with European realism represented by Dickens, Tolstoy or Balzac is significantly revealed while its complex nature as a sue generis of the American romance is confirmed anew. But its more rigorous scrutiny awaits a close reading of The Scarlet Letter.
